Labor and Greens have spent the past fortnight thrashing out a deal which will allow Andrew Barr's party to form government. The parties are familiar with the process. The Greens are in a far stronger bargaining position this time after winning 6 of 25 seats at #ACTvotes2020
At #ACTvotes2020, Labor won 10 seats - three short of a majority in the 25 seat ACT Legislative Assembly. That means they need the help of Shane Rattenbury's ACT Greens to form government.

Impressive #Canberra participation rates & early voting! “99.5% of eligible voters in the ACT enrolled. Of enrolled, 89% voted, higher than 2016. 77% of voters cast vote before election day, informal voting just 1.3%, a new record low compared to 2.5%” #ACTpol #actvotes2020
